What I wish ppl understood is that we aren't allowed to reject things just because we don't like Palpatine, or Obidala, or OC's, for example. If that came back to an editor as the sole reason for rejection, that reviewer would most likely be fired.

Seriously.

Now, of course, diverse preferences do exist among the staff. If we get one that for any reason just rankles us so terribly that we can't give it a fair shake (not that this occurs on a regular basis, but we know how picky SW fans are in general ... it could happen), we have to unclaim it and let someone else take it. In this way, your story will get picked up by someone who takes it assuming they will enjoy it, and really wants to give it a fair shake.

The whole idea is you're supposed to judge writing, not the personal likes and dislikes of the author.

What I wish ppl understood is that we aren't allowed to reject things just because we don't like Palpatine, or Obidala, or OC's, for example. If that came back to an editor as the sole reason for rejection, that reviewer would most likely be fired.



In addition to this, it's also no secret that there friendships and feuds here in the forums. To alleviate this, reviewers aren't supposed to review fics submitted by their friends and aren't allowed to review fics from somebody they do not get along with it.


I know I've heard people say that they don't submit because you supposedly have to be friends with someone on the staff to get accepted, but that just isn't true.
